• 程序员都看不懂的代码


    import os                        # 导入os模块
    path='D:\\'                        # 要创建文件夹的路径
    # 以只读方式打开文件
    with open('product.txt','r',encoding='utf-8') as f:
        for line in f.readlines():            # 读取所有行
            dirpath=path+line.strip()        # 拼接要创建的文件夹路径
            if not os.path.exists(dirpath):        # 判断路径不存在
                os.mkdir(dirpath)            # 创建文件夹
    print('创建完成……')
    os.startfile(path)                # 打开路径

    import datetime            # 导入日期时间模块
    # 测试方法一的执行时间
    st = datetime.datetime.now()    # 获取开始时间
    ‘’’开始字符串拼接’’’
    s = “”                # 定义空字符串
    for i in range(0,10000):        # 循环10000次
        s += str(i)            # 进行字符串拼接
    ‘’’结束字符串拼接’’’
    et = datetime.datetime.now()    # 获取结束时间
    print(et-st)            # 输出所用时间

    import datetime            # 导入日期时间模块
    st = datetime.datetime.now()    # 获取开始时间
    ‘’’开始字符串拼接’’’
    s = []  # 定义空列表
    for i in range(0,10000):        # 循环10000次
        s.append(str(i))            # 追加到列表
    “”.join(s)                    # 将列表的元素合并为字符串
    ‘’’结束字符串拼接’’’
    et = datetime.datetime.now()        # 获取结束时间
    print(et-st)                # 输出所用时间

  • 相关阅读:
    纵横职场的8招秘诀,高手都这么干
    SystemVerilog学习(3)——数组
    使用【Python+Appium】实现自动化测试
    海洋捕食者算法(Matlab代码实现)
    SpringBoot 如何解决跨域问题
    C\C++基础
    (PC+WAP)织梦模板冲压模具类网站
    【手写模拟Spring底层原理】
    VMWare不使用简易安装,手动安装ISO操作手册
    useEffect 和useLayoutEffect 的区别
  • 原文地址:https://blog.csdn.net/s13166803785/article/details/125514709